Boffin Posted February 29, 2008 Share Posted February 29, 2008 The latest news is that he is on his way back to the UK. The main concern is that he would be a highly prized target for the Taleban, placing all the soldiers in his unit at higher risk. I admire his determination to carry out service as an ordinary soldier following in his family tradition. His uncle, Prince Andrew, was a naval helicopter pilot during the Falklands war and his grandfather, Prince Philip, served on several warships during WWII. Andy BBC news story Andy Link to comment
